spellcheck issue on square terminal

We have a square terminal at our gallery. We have to write descriptions for every item sold. Just above the keyboard, as you start to type, it guesses what words you're typing, like an autocorrect but it doesn't behave as an autocorrect. The words it's putting up there are completely different than what you're typing.

 

For example, trying to type in "lavender," the suggested words are "leaf, he, piece, large."

 

This really slows down transactions. Any ideas what is going on?
